A swimsuit commercial starring model Bar Refaeli has been nixed by Israeli broadcasters after being deemed too racy. Bar Refaeli stars in the ad for her own swimwear line Hoodies. The censored ad for her own swimwear line, Hoodies, shows the Israeli stunner frolicking on the beach and getting changed behind a car door — and the racy ad includes close-ups of her pert bottom and ample cleavage. Israeli television and radio officials decided close-ups of her backside and a segment in which she appears to be nude must be deleted.
And even with the edits, the saucy commercial can only appear after 10 p.m. Bar Refaeli's new advert for her 'Bar for HOODIES' swimsuit line was deemed too racy for Israeli television. A shot from Bar Refaeli’s sexy new ad for her swimsuit line. Refaeli, who is married to businessman Adi Ezra, filmed the ad when she was three months pregnant with her first child. It's not the first time the Sports Illustrated cover girl has gotten into hot water with Israeli broadcasters. In April 2014, an ad featuring Refaeli in bed with a purple-hued puppet was also banned from airing before 10 p.m. because it contained "too many sexual insinuations."Bar Refaeli Swimwear Ad Censored in Israel Close-ups of the supermodel’s backside are a no-no, broadcasting authority says.
